Math Problem Statement

9(8-3) ÷ [6 ÷ 2 + (8 + 5)]

Solution

The equation visible in the image is:

9(83)÷[6÷2+(8+5)]9 \left( 8 - 3 \right) \div \left[ 6 \div 2 + (8 + 5) \right]

Let's break this down step by step:

  1. Simplify inside the parentheses first: \quad \text{and} \quad 8 + 5 = 13$$ So the equation becomes: $$9(5) \div \left[ 6 \div 2 + 13 \right]$$
  2. Simplify inside the brackets: \quad \text{so} \quad 3 + 13 = 16$$ Now the equation is: $$9(5) \div 16$$
  3. Multiply and divide: \quad \text{so} \quad 45 \div 16 = 2.8125$$

Thus, the result of the expression is 2.8125.
